> Deprecate TSMimeHdrFieldValueStringInsert() (and family)

> It seems to be that TSMimeHdrFieldValueStringInsert() is really just a subset 
> of TSMimeHdrFieldValueStringSet(). This just makes for confusing APIs, i.e. 
> which one do I use when? The alternative would be to remove the "idx" 
> argument to the TSMimeHdrFieldValueStringSet() method, but that would then 
> break API and ABI compatibility.
> Also, as James found out, the docs are less than clear. Set() needs to be 
> called with an idx of -1 for it to actually be a Set() operation. With idx 
> >=0, TSMimeHdrFieldValueStringSet() is actually identical to 
> TSMimeHdrFieldValueStringInsert()....
